Woman charged with 54 counts of animal cruelty after animal rescue caught fire

Summary by WREG News
BARTLETT, Tenn. -- It's been more than a year since a fire broke out at an animal rescue and killed animals trapped inside. The woman in charge of that rescue is now facing charges. Amy Moore has now been charged with 54 counts of cruelty to animals. According to the indictment WREG Investigators uncovered, the charges involve 48 dogs and six cats.
